Online gambling in Bangladesh is regulated by the Information and Communication Technology (ICT) Act of 2006. According to this act, any form of online gambling is considered illegal in Bangladesh, including Chicken Game gambling. The act prohibits the use of electronic devices for the purpose of betting or wagering, and violators can face fines and/or imprisonment.
Despite the strict regulations, online gambling platforms continue to operate in Bangladesh, offering a variety of games, including Chicken Game gambling. These platforms often operate under the guise of skill-based games or social networking sites, making it difficult for law enforcement agencies to shut them down.

In light of these concerns, law enforcement agencies in Bangladesh have started cracking down on online gambling activities, including Chicken Game gambling. In 2019, the Bangladesh Telecommunication Regulatory Commission (BTRC) ordered internet service providers to block access to over 400 gambling websites, including popular platforms offering Chicken Game gambling.
Despite these efforts, the legality of online gambling, including Chicken Game gambling, remains a contentious issue in Bangladesh. While some argue that the government should take a more proactive approach to regulating online gambling to protect consumers and prevent illegal activities, others believe that individuals should have the freedom to engage in online gambling as they see fit.
